Human growth hormone, or somatotropin, is a full-length protein reference used to study direct growth hormone receptor activation. Research examines JAK2 and STAT signaling, IGF-1 expression, protein and lipid metabolism, cell growth, endocrine feedback, and tissue-specific receptor responses. It differs fundamentally from GHRH analogs and ghrelin-receptor secretagogues, which act upstream to stimulate endogenous GH release in experimental systems. HGH is selected when the project requires the hormone itself as the signaling input or comparator. 想定される機序
Binds the growth-hormone receptor, causing receptor dimer rearrangement and activation of JAK2-STAT, MAPK, and PI3K-AKT signaling. It also induces IGF-1 production, especially in the liver, and directly influences lipid, carbohydrate, and protein metabolism.
研究で報告された作用
- Cell and human studies report increased IGF-1, protein synthesis, nitrogen retention, lipolysis, and changes in body composition.
- Growth-hormone signaling can reduce insulin sensitivity and increase glucose, fluid retention, tissue growth, and other dose-related systemic effects.
- Long-term or excessive exposure is associated with edema, arthralgia, carpal-tunnel symptoms, glucose intolerance, and growth-related risks.
一般的な研究エンドポイント
Growth-hormone receptor phosphorylation, JAK2-STAT signaling, IGF-1 and binding proteins, nitrogen balance, protein synthesis, lipolysis, glucose and insulin, fluid balance, and tissue growth.
